Transaction 38d76c7011a15a857adef8a74007f2909367d64edaf6341eb0fca8d618d30e69
1 Input
2 Outputs
- 38d76c7011a15a857adef8a74007f2909367d64edaf6341eb0fca8d618d30e69:0
- 38d76c7011a15a857adef8a74007f2909367d64edaf6341eb0fca8d618d30e69:1
value 125342771
address 18MYyZbSsFzhD9SkMRtsbHSPCvMkHbk9EC
value 16643870
address 1FkDvP19NsLtC77qJ1kDQqXV6Pzpa7bbVu